    The NEW Strike Industries Strike Gear Hook Adapter

    Hook Adapter

    The Strike Gear Hook Adapter has hook on both sides. This allows users to attach two items that have loop panels. More specifically, this works with the Strike Boogeyman Chest Rig Bag. Adding the Hook Adapter to the Boogeyman makes it possible to connect it to loop panels on the front of your preferred plate carrier. The Boogeyman then becomes an easy-to-access, modular admin pouch, mag carrier, or whatever you need it to be.

    Hook Adapter

    • Length: 6.00″
    • Width: 4.38″
    • Weight: 0.60 oz
    • MSRP: $12.95
